Yanda Shops for Shoes

Cool Boots Before I left Canada, Bobbie-Sue Ticklepinky, the receptionist at Tsuga, made a request that I find some cool shoes for her. After a great deal of searching, I found this pair while attending London Fashion Week. They would have been perfect.

Unfortunately, they were already on someone else's feet. Her name was Tatiana Carbunkle and she was an 18 year old model from Iceland. She allowed me to be photographed with the boots but absolutely refused to let me purchase them.

After this photo was snapped, I tried taking them by force, but was immediately restrained by security guards who beat on me like a rubber gong. Bleeding profusely, I struggled to the bar and bravely ordered a gin and tonic which cost me (absolute God's truth here) £4.50. Please note that at current exchange rates this is roughly the equivalent of $10,000 CDN. It was at that point that I became disillusioned with the fashion world.
